Norman Park flood & bushfire risk

Of Norman Park’s 4,235 mapped properties, 29.4% are in a mapped flood area and 2.1% are in a bushfire hazard area.

Crime near Norman Park

Norman Park sits in the Morningside police division, which recorded 4,297 reported offences in the 12 months to Jun 2026.

Zoning in Norman Park

Norman Park is mostly residential. The most common zones:

Residential46.9% of properties

Low–medium density residential — a mix of houses, townhouses and small unit blocks.

Zone: LMR2 - Low-medium density residential (2 or 3 storey mix)

Residential30.1% of properties

Character / infill residential — older-style homes, with some infill like townhouses or duplexes allowed.

Zone: CR2 - Infill housing

Residential10.1% of properties

Low density residential — mostly detached houses on standard suburban blocks.

Zone: LDR - Low density residential

Who lives in Norman Park

At the 2021 Census, 20.9% of Norman Park’s 6,842 residents were born overseas.
